Activated Charcoal Absorbent Dressings Market - Global Forecast 2026-2032

The Activated Charcoal Absorbent Dressings Market size was estimated at USD 748.36 million in 2025 and expected to reach USD 806.53 million in 2026, at a CAGR of 7.56% to reach USD 1,246.74 million by 2032.

Exploring How Activated Charcoal Absorbent Dressings Are Revolutionizing Wound Management Through Enhanced Odor Control and Moisture Regulation

Activated charcoal absorbent dressings have emerged as a pivotal innovation within the advanced wound care sector, combining time-tested adsorptive properties of charcoal with modern dressing technologies. Originally recognized for its broad-spectrum odor absorption in non-medical applications, activated charcoal has been incorporated into wound dressings to address persistent challenges in managing exudate odor and microbial balance at the wound site. Over the past decade, growing awareness of chronic wounds and increasing demand for patient-centric care have converged to elevate the role of these dressings across diverse healthcare settings.

Clinicians and patients alike value charcoal-based dressings for their ability to maintain a balanced moisture environment while mitigating malodor, thereby improving patient comfort and compliance. As a result, manufacturers have invested heavily in refining charcoal integration methods, combining it with superabsorbent polymers and breathable substrates. This has given rise to next-generation dressings that not only manage fluid and odor but also support autolytic debridement, making them suitable for complex wound types ranging from diabetic foot ulcers to pressure injuries.

Identifying Key Technological and Regulatory Shifts That Are Reshaping Activated Charcoal Dressing Development and Adoption Across Healthcare Settings

Over the last several years, the landscape of activated charcoal absorbent dressings has been reshaped by an interplay of technological breakthroughs and regulatory evolutions. Innovations in substrate engineering have enabled the synthesis of nanoporous charcoal matrices that maximize surface area and adsorption capacity. Concurrently, the integration of moisture-responsive polymers has moved dressing efficiency beyond odor control, promoting a regulated wound microenvironment conducive to healing.

Regulators have likewise influenced product development trajectories. In 2024, the FDA issued updated guidance clarifying classification pathways for dressings containing novel adsorbents, streamlining the approval process for manufacturers able to demonstrate bio-compatibility and sterility. Parallel developments in Europe’s Medical Device Regulation have mandated enhanced clinical evidence for antimicrobial dressings, encouraging vendors to invest in robust clinical trials.

Healthcare delivery models have shifted in response to value-based payment frameworks and growing home healthcare utilization. This transition has prompted manufacturers to design dressings optimized for patient self-application, ease of monitoring, and compatibility with telehealth wound-care platforms. At the same time, sustainability trends have spurred efforts to source charcoal from renewable biomass and introduce recyclable packaging, aligning product portfolios with broader environmental goals.

Collectively, these shifts are driving a new era in which activated charcoal dressings not only address traditional performance criteria but also meet heightened expectations for regulatory compliance, patient empowerment, and sustainability.

Assessing How Recent United States Tariff Adjustments in 2025 Are Affecting Supply Chains Cost Structures and Competitive Dynamics in Absorbent Dressings

The cumulative impact of United States tariffs enacted through 2025 has exerted a multifaceted influence on the supply chain dynamics and cost structures within the absorbent dressing market. Building on Section 301 measures introduced earlier, additional levies on imported medical dressings and raw materials reached as high as 25 percent for certain categories in mid-2025. This escalation prompted importers to reassess sourcing strategies and triggers among manufacturers to fortify domestic operations.

As import costs rose, suppliers experienced margin compression, compelling price adjustments that reverberated through both institutional procurement and retail channels. Purchasing departments at hospitals and home care providers negotiated longer contract terms to mitigate budgetary unpredictability, while some regional distributors opted for consolidated shipments to achieve freight efficiencies. Simultaneously, manufacturing plants in North America accelerated capacity expansions and near-shored key production elements to limit exposure to cross-border duties.

In response, leading players forged partnerships with specialty fiber producers in the U.S. and Mexico to secure preferential trade treatment under USMCA. At the same time, a wave of mergers and acquisitions sought to integrate vertically within localized supply chains, offering resilience against further policy shifts. Although cost pressures have been significant, downstream stakeholders have mitigated impact through incremental price surcharges and a renewed emphasis on value demonstration, underscoring the importance of clinical evidence to justify premium technologies.

Deriving Actionable Insights from End User Wound Type Dressing Form and Distribution Channel Segmentation to Pinpoint Growth Opportunities

Analyzing the market through the lens of end user segmentation reveals differentiated growth trajectories for activated charcoal absorptive solutions. In clinics and outpatient wound care centers, demand is driven by the need for specialized treatments that deliver consistent odor management and reduce dressing change frequency. Meanwhile, hospitals prioritize multifunctional formats capable of addressing a spectrum of wound types, from surgical incisions to traumatic skin loss, making composite charcoal dressings particularly attractive. Within home healthcare, the emphasis lies on user-friendly pads and sheets, enabling non-clinical caregivers to maintain continuity of care without extensive training.

When considering wound type segmentation, diabetic foot ulcers represent a pivotal category due to their chronic nature and exudate profiles, prompting manufacturers to tailor pad designs with targeted adsorption gradients. Pressure ulcer management likewise benefits from the conformability of ribbon-style charcoal appliqués, especially in anatomically challenging regions such as the sacrum. Surgical wounds often leverage sheet-based dressings that evenly disperse moisture over post-operative sites, whereas traumatic wounds demand robust composite dressings that integrate both absorbent cores and antimicrobial charcoal layers. Venous leg ulcers, characterized by high exudate volumes over protracted healing periods, have catalyzed innovation in durable, high-capacity sheet systems.

Form factor influences user preferences, as composite dressings provide turnkey performance but at a higher price point. Pads appeal to cost-sensitive channels, ribbons serve niche cavity applications, and sheets cover large surface area wounds efficiently. Distribution channel considerations further shape market strategies. Direct sales to hospital procurement teams facilitate complex formulary integrations, while hospital pharmacies and retail pharmacies offer point-of-care accessibility. Online pharmacies, segmented into B2B wholesales and direct-to-consumer platforms, have expanded adoption among remote and home-bound patients. Retail pharmacies, encompassing both chain operations and independent stores, round out the ecosystem by offering over-the-counter availability and clinical counsel in community settings.

Uncovering Regional Market Nuances Across the Americas Europe Middle East Africa and Asia Pacific That Drive Demand for Charcoal Dressings

Regional dynamics in the Americas underscore a mature market environment characterized by established hospital networks and a well-developed home-health ecosystem. In the United States and Canada, reimbursement frameworks that reward reduced readmissions and shorter healing times have elevated adoption of premium charcoal dressings in acute and post-acute care settings. Latin American markets, while more price-sensitive, are witnessing gradual uptake driven by partnerships between local distributors and multinational manufacturers offering tiered product portfolios.

Within Europe, Middle East, and Africa, regulatory harmonization under the EU framework continues to facilitate cross-border product launches, but cost constraints in public health systems encourage multi tender bidding and competitive pricing. The Middle East is experiencing heightened demand through medical tourism hubs in the United Arab Emirates and Saudi Arabia, whereas Africa remains an emerging frontier supported by donor-funded initiatives targeting infection control in wound care.

In Asia-Pacific, burgeoning diabetic populations in China and India are fueling growth in both hospital and home healthcare channels. Government investments in healthcare infrastructure across Southeast Asia are enhancing distribution capabilities, enabling remote regions to access advanced dressing solutions. Japan and Australia, with aging demographics, place a premium on patient comfort and quality-of-life improvements, making odor-control features especially valued. Across all regions, local manufacturing alliances and technology transfer agreements have become integral to balancing cost pressures with regulatory compliance, reinforcing the geographic nuances that influence strategic planning.
